Crossing Cinema: the Diary Film, the Essay Film, and the Voice of I
This book focuses on the unique forms of expression in the diary film and the essay film, especially how authorship of filmmakers can be integrated in the voice-over as a narrative strategy in first-person cinema. The book is divided into two sections: the first section “essays” contains three chapters, and in these chapters I use films of Liu Na’Ou, Hollis Frampton, Jonas Mekas, and José Luis Guerín as cases for filmic textual analyses, to discuss the issues of authorial presence, the voiceover narration, and audiovisual structure.
